            Baseball Preview: Nevada Union Miners vs. Sutter Huskies        
        
		
        
        
            The Nevada Union Miners are taking a road trip to  take on the Sutter Huskies  at 4:00  p.m.  on Wednesday. Nevada Union is coming into the  matchup on  a  five-game losing streak.
On Friday, Nevada Union came up short against Yuba City  and fell  8-4.
  Isaac Arnerich was cooking despite his team's loss,   going 2-for-3 with one  home run and two  RBI.  Nate Hundemer also deserves some recognition as  he  hit his first  triple of the season.
Sutter's found some homefield redemption this week after a  overtime loss to Destiny Christian Academy on Friday. The Huskies skirted past the Lions  2-1.
 Sam Cheatle made a big impact while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ound,   tossing two innings while giving up   no  earned runs or  hits. He has been consistent: he hasn't  given up  more than two  walks in six consecutive appearances. He was also solid in the batter's box,  going 2-for-3 with two  doubles and one  run. Those  two  doubles gave  him a new career-high.
 In other pitching news, Sutter got a great performance from  Mason McCall as he  struck out six batters over  five innings while giving up just one earned run off   seven  hits. McCall has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't  given up  more than two  walks in eight consecutive appearances.
 Cheatle wasn't  the only one making solid contact as  three players wound up with at least one hit. One of them was  Carson Bishop, who  went 1-for-3 with one  stolen base and one  run.
 Sutter  hit smart and  finished the game with only one  strikeout. The team has now struck out at least three batters  in three consecutive  contests.
 Sutter is  on a roll lately: they've  won 13 of their last 14 games. That's provided a nice bump to their 26-4 record  this season. Those  wins came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 2.3 runs on average over those games. As for Nevada Union, their loss dropped their record down to 10-18.
 Nevada Union came up short against Sutter in their previous meeting  back in March of 2024, falling  10-6. Can the Miners avenge their  def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
